I got the CHMSL LED unit from Southern Car Parts, its a Brite Ideas
unit I believe.

The LEDs are no where near as bright as I expected, I am 1/2 tempted
to open the unit and change the resistors to make the Osrams come
alive. I want burnt retinas when I jam on the brakes. The Osram LEDs
are very bright, I suspect them turned them down to be nice to
people or meet DOT specs.
